The leader whose village was near the North bank of the Cedar Creek bank, ...Environmental tragedy followed the forced removal of the Potawatomi from northern Indiana. The Yellow River, a tributary of the Kankakee River, ran through Menominee’s Reservation. Rivers, lakes, and wetlands were crucial to Potawatomi food systems and medicines, while also providing their primary mode of transportation via canoes.48 Kitchen jobs available in Pearson, WI on Indeed.com. The Citizen Potawatomi Nation is the federally-recognized government of our people and represents over 38,000 tribal members. It acts under a ratified Constitution and includes executive, legislative, and judicial branches. This industry is rapidly growing, but along with the rapidly growing industry comes a lot of questions.CLASS. The Potawatomi are a band of Native Americans who originally settled near Lake Michigan. Their name translates to "People of the Fire," relating to their role as keepers of the council fire. To keep their traditions alive, the Potawatomi hold an annual three-day-long powwow, or celebration of traditional food, clothing, song and dance.
